Friday, October 2, 2009

Iines is now a happy(?) neuter-lady

Iines was sterlized yesterday and is now recovering from operation. Everything went well and there were no visible signs of anything odd. I was curious to find out what the uterus looked like after she has been on the pill, but nothing unusual was found.

I have been a bit stressed out about the pills... I'm not taking any pills myself, so I'm not so happy giving them to my cats either. Iines was first on the pill for 3 months before the first kittens, then I was forced to put her back on the pill when the kittens were 10 weeks old and she had already had one heat and was soon starging another one. That time she was on the pill for 4 months before the second kittens and now again little over 3 months.

I know it's probably not the wisest move to sterilize her, but still... she didn't seem to get any weight even though she was on the pill (on the contrary - she was losing weight instead). According to FIFe rules, I would have had the possibility to mate her for the third time anytime I liked, but she wasn't ready for another litter.

It would have been nice to get more kittens from her, but things don't always go as planned. At least she had two litters and I still have Lilli.
